When will we see publication of the Bill to provide for the exchange of criminal records information with other EU member states and other designated states? There was a very violent robbery in Trim last week where criminal gangs robbed jewellery shops. In the past two to three years 30 to 40 jewellery shops throughout the country have been robbed. These people leave the country within 24 hours. Great Britain is introducing new border control laws and passport rules and we need to look at this. It is a serious problem. The gentleman in my constituency who was robbed is now closing his business after last week's robbery. What went on was scandalous. We have to look at border controls and passport rules. There is no point in flashing a passport and letting people in just because they are from the EU. We have to look at it. It is a serious problem.
